Superior HealthPlan Medicare Advantage is a Medicare Advantage program available across select counties in Texas, designed for older adults who qualify for both Medicare and Medicaid benefits. These dual-eligible plans combine medical, hospital, and prescription drug coverage with coordinated services to provide a seamless healthcare experience.
The program’s mission is to deliver high-quality, person-centered care that empowers seniors to manage chronic conditions, stay active, and maintain independent lives. Superior HealthPlan focuses on improving access, coordination, and overall health outcomes through an integrated care approach.
As part of the Centene family of companies, Superior HealthPlan expanded its Medicare offerings in the early 2000s to meet the needs of aging adults and dual-eligible members across Texas.
• Offers Dual Special Needs Plans (D-SNP) for Medicare and Medicaid beneficiaries.
• Provides dental, vision, hearing, and fitness benefits to enhance quality of life.
• Implements customized care planning for individuals with complex medical needs.
• Committed to coordinated, compassionate care for Texas seniors and families.

Superior Health Plan Medicare Advantage is a health insurance plan that includes Medicare Part A and Part B coverage, along with additional benefits such as prescription drugs, dental, vision, and hearing services for seniors.

Superior Health Plan Medicare Advantage covers all services under Medicare Parts A and B, prescription drugs (Part D), dental, vision, hearing, and wellness programs.
You can enroll by contacting Superior Health Plan directly or visiting their website during the Medicare Annual Enrollment Period or Special Enrollment Period.
Yes. Superior Health Plan Medicare Advantage plans include prescription drug coverage under Medicare Part D.
Yes. Out-of-network services may be covered; however, members could incur higher out-of-pocket costs for these services.
You can find in-network doctors by searching the Superior Health Plan provider directory or contacting their customer service for assistance.
Yes. Superior Health Plan Medicare Advantage includes preventive care services such as screenings, immunizations, and wellness exams—at no additional cost to members.
Yes. Dental and vision coverage are included in many Superior Health Plan Medicare Advantage options. Check your specific plan details for coverage information.
The Superior Health Plan online portal allows members to manage their plan, track claims, review benefits, and locate in-network healthcare providers.
